Can an offset mortgage help us reduce the term of our mortgage?

Posted on 26 February 2008


Katie,

I'm considering an offset mortgage with a term of 14 years and a sum of £73,500.  My wife and I have savings of £25,000. We earn bonuses which give us lump sums to reduce the debt further, approximately every 6 months (£1,000 to £1,500). We would like to reduce the term of our mortgage with a view to paying it off asap. Is an offset mortgage the way to go?

Hi Steve,

Yes, you certainly have sufficient savings to make offsetting worth your while. It's a great way to manage your money.  Make sure you know the difference between gross offsetting and net offsetting. Scottish Widows, Intelligent Finance, Accord and Abbey have the best ones for fixed or tracker at the moment, and also have a look at the One accounts from Royal Bank of Scotland.
